SCHENECTADY — A man who was on the run from police for more than a decade after being charged with criminal sex acts in New Jersey was arrested in Schenectady on Thursday, according to the U.S. Marshals Service.
A warrant for the arrest of Adan Lemus, 49, was issued in 2014 after he didn’t appear in court to face charges of criminal sexual contact, according to a news release from the U.S. Marshals Service. He’s accused of using “physical force on a victim for sexual gratification,” police said.
Lemus was arrested in New Jersey in 2013 and, after he was released on bond, he fled the state, the Marshals Service said…
